Nytch is an online marketplace for treasure hunters to find and shop local businesses for vintage and pre-loved items.
Nytch tackles the problem of undigitized inventory by connecting shopper searches and requests to local businesses that have enormous backlogs of unique and one-off items that will never appear online.
Nytch helps shoppers score great finds, and helps sellers prioritize their products. Nytch improves foot traffic for these businesses, and supports the circle of Finding.

Partnering with Goodwill Industries
As Head of Design and Co-Founder, I led the strategy to bypass fragmented supply by securing high-impact partnerships with multiple national Goodwill regions and SMBs. This aggregated a massive, $1 billion-plus inventory pool, transforming Nytch into a high-utility engine for local treasure hunters.
Strategic Partnerships: I managed the supply-side partner relationships, working directly with regional leadership to integrate their disparate inventory systems into a unified mobile platform.
Strategic GTM: I focused our GTM strategy on the Columbia Willamette region. The region is known for its exceptionally active thrifting culture, featuring four “boutique”-brand locations in the region. In addition, the GICW region is a hub of sneaker culture known for rare and limited Nike finds.
